The USDA Agricultural Research Service is awarding a contract to develop genomic breeding values for Atlantic salmon under a total small business set-aside, targeting innovative genetic advancement in aquaculture. This effort focuses on enhancing traits critical to sustainable salmon production through advanced genomic tools, with the work to be performed in Franklin, Maine, while administrative oversight resides at the Beltsville, Maryland facility. The contract, issued under NAICS code 541380 for other scientific and technical consulting services, is open exclusively to small businesses and reflects a strategic investment in improving fisheries productivity through data-driven breeding programs. Jacob Toft of the USDA is the designated point of contact for all communications related to this initiative.
